Bitwolf Nov 15, 2024 @ 6:54pm 
This issue can also appear on linux systems when you attempt to uninstall a proton that youve forced a game to use, so knowing that my best guess is valve borked the dependancies.

You cant uninstall HL 2 because episode one needs it, and you cant uninstall episode one because HL2 needs it. Repeat for all HL 2 games.

ruski42 Nov 17, 2024 @ 1:57am 
Settings --> Downloads --> Clear Cache

I cleared out the Download's cache and redownloaded EP1 and EP2 and now they can start from the Half-Life 2 launcher and from Tools. Let me know if this helped you. :)
